how do you find the slope and the y-intercept of y=6x-12

Respuesta :

ChoiSungHyun
ChoiSungHyun ChoiSungHyun
  • 03-09-2020

Answer:

Slope = 6, y-intercept = -12.

Step-by-step explanation:

Slope is the coefficient of the x-term, which is 6 in this case.

The y intercept is the constant term that comes after the x-term, which is -12.
